| Tagline | Google Docs with an AI collaborator baked in. | Spreadsheets with AI + live integrations baked in. | Commercially safe image gen, deeply integrated with Photoshop. | Anthropic's CLI agent. Opus-powered, operates on your repo directly. |
| Category | writing | data | image | coding |
| Pricing | Free + $12/mo | Free + $19-$89/user/mo | Free + included with Creative Cloud | Part of Claude Pro/Max/Team plans |
| Best for | Essays, long-form drafts, thinking on the page. | Ops teams, marketers, anyone building dashboards from multiple sources. | Anyone in Creative Cloud. Brands that need copyright clarity. | Developers who want an agent, not autocomplete. Large refactors, tests, docs. |
